What is an Interest Amortization Schedule?

An Interest Amortization Schedule is a financial tool that outlines the methodical repayment of a loan over time. It details each payment's principal and interest components, enabling borrowers to see how their debt decreases. This type of schedule is crucial for individuals and organizations managing loans, as it helps track payment schedules and overall financial health.

Why organizations use an Interest Amortization Schedule

Organizations rely on Interest Amortization Schedules for several reasons. Primarily, they provide clarity on payment structures and timelines, which aids in budget planning. They also assist in understanding how interest accrues within a loan, helping finance teams make informed decisions. Furthermore, these schedules simplify the reporting process for both stakeholders and tax purposes.

Typical industries and workflows that depend on Interest Amortization Schedule

Numerous industries benefit from Interest Amortization Schedules, particularly finance, real estate, and banking. For example, mortgage lenders often create detailed schedules for clients, while corporate finance teams use them for budgeting and forecasting. Understanding industry-specific workflows helps tailor the use of schedules to meet specific needs effectively.

To calculate amortization, first multiply your principal balance by your interest rate. Next, divide that by 12 months to know your interest fee for your current month. Finally, subtract that interest fee from your total monthly payment. What remains is how much will go toward principal for that month.
As these payments are periodic, you can schedule them beforehand to see the principal and interest amount you'll need to pay until you fully settle the loan. In Google Sheets, you can use the PMT, PPMT, and IPMT functions to create your own loan amortization schedule.
